How Our Kitchen Water Removal Service Actually Works
We’ll begin by assessing the damage and identifying the source of the leak. Our technicians will then use specialized equipment to detect hidden water damage and dry out affected areas. This may involve setting up containment procedures, using desiccants, and deploying specialized drying equipment. The goal is to prevent further damage and get your kitchen back to its original state as quickly as possible.
Step 1: Assess and Contain
We’ll inspect your kitchen to find out the extent of the damage. This involves checking for water flow, moisture levels, and potential points of entry. Our technicians will then set up containment procedures to prevent further water damage and protect your property.
Step 2: Extract and Dry
Next, we’ll use specialized equipment to extract water from affected areas. This may involve using wet vacuums, pumps, and desiccants to remove as much water as possible. Once the water is removed, we’ll use specialized drying equipment to dry out affected areas and prevent mold and bacterial growth.
Step 3: Clean and Disinfect
After the water is removed and the area is dry, we’ll clean and disinfect the affected areas to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. This involves using spec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to remove any remaining moisture and contaminants.
Step 4: Restore and Repair
Finally, we’ll work with you to restore and repair any damaged areas. This may involve replacing cabinets, countertops, and flooring, as well as repairing any structural damage. Our goal is to get your kitchen back to its original state as quickly and efficiently as possible.

Warning Signs You Need Kitchen Water Removal
Don’t ignore these warning signs, as they can show a larger issue that needs to be addressed.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ong musty odors in your kitchen can be a sign of water damage or mold growth. If you notice a persistent, unpleasant smell, it’s time to call in the professionals.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a leak or water damage. If you notice any discoloration or staining, it’s essential to address the issue ASAP.
Bubbles in Your Flooring or Walls
Bubbles in your flooring or walls can be a sign of water damage or structural problems. If you notice any bubbles or cracks, it’s crucial to address the issue immediately.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or unevenness.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s time to investigate further.
Visible Water Leaks
Visible water leaks under your sink, around your appliances, or in your walls can be a sign of a bigger issue.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to further damage and costly repairs.

Kitchen Water Removal Cost in Rotonda West, FL
The cost of kitchen water removal in Rotonda West, FL can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Our estimates typically range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the scope of the job and the equipment required.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500-$1,500 | Severity of water damage, size of affected area |
| Cleaning and disinfecting | $100-$500 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ning solutions required |
| Restoration and repair | $500-$2,500 | Severity of water damage, type of materials required for repair |
| Containment procedures | $100-$500 | Size of affected area, type of containment equipment required |
The final cost of kitchen water removal will depend on the specific services required and the equipment needed to complete the job. We offer free estimates and can provide a detailed breakdown of the costs involved.

Common Questions About Kitchen Water Removal
Q: What is the average cost of kitchen water removal?
A: The average cost of kitchen water removal can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Our estimates typically range from $500 to $2,500.
Q: How long does kitchen water removal take?
A: The time it takes to complete kitchen water removal can vary depending on the complexity of the job and the equipment required. But, most jobs can be completed within 3-5 days.
Q: Is kitchen water removal covered by insurance?
A: Some insurance policies may cover kitchen water removal, but it depends on the specifics of your policy and the circumstances of the damage. We recommend checking with your insurance provider to see what is covered.
Q: Can I do kitchen water removal myself?
A: While it may be tempting to try to tackle kitchen water removal on your own, it’s not always the best idea. Water damage can be a complex and time-consuming process, and trying to do it yourself can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
